Dear Mr. Frazee:

This is in response to your February 9,1994 letter to Mr. Bangart requesting a review and comment on your Quality Management (QM) Rule.

The following comments are offered for your consideration:

1.

WAC 246-239-022 and WAC 246-240-015 indicate that -

"a written directive is not required when an authorized user personally assays and administers the dosage provided the pertinent facts are recorded as otherwise required."

By not requiring a written directive there may be a problem with enforcement if a misadministration occurs. We recommend that you include a requirement for a written directive which would address this potential problem.

2.

Your proposed QM rule does not address 10 CFR 35.32 (b) (1) which requires that procedures be developed for reviewing the effectiveness of the QM program.

We recommend that you include this provision in your QM rule.

You should also be aware that the definitions in Part 35.2, which are equivalent to WAC 246-240-010(3)(c) and (5)(b)(iii), are being revised through the proposed final radiopharmacy rulemaking action. These changes to the Part 35 language are presented below referencing the corresponding section in Washington regulations:

Part 35.2 (WAC 246-240-010(3)(c))

"a teletherapy radiation dose when the calculated weekly administered dose exceeds the weekly prescribed dose by fifteen percent or more of the weekly dosage;" or Part 35.2 (WAC 246-240-010(5)(b)(iii))

"when the calculated weekly administered dose exceeds the weekly prescribed dose by thirty percent or more of the weekly prescribed dosage."
